Originally posted by: Sevb32
So if I use DVD FLICK to burn this on a DVD5, will I have any problems getting all the material on it without bad compression picture quality? Is there a way I can put just the film on one DVD and the extras on another DVD? DVDFLICK has a setting for NTSC, if this is the PAL version will I have any trouble converting it? Yes, I will be fist to tell you what an idiot I am when it comes to this stuff.
So if I use DVD FLICK to burn this on a DVD5, will I have any problems getting all the material on it without bad compression picture quality? Is there a way I can put just the film on one DVD and the extras on another DVD? DVDFLICK has a setting for NTSC, if this is the PAL version will I have any trouble converting it? Yes, I will be fist to tell you what an idiot I am when it comes to this stuff.
The one out tomorrow is a DVD-5 so it will fit on a single layer DVD. You won't have to shrink it. If you need NTSC then you'll have to wait a week or so until the NTSC DVD-5 is available. I wouldn't shrink the DVD-9 just for the extras. There are extras on the DVD-5 but shrinking the whole DVD-9 won't give you very good results. The bitrate for the movie would be down to about 3200kbps (maybe even less) in order to keep the extras, which isn't very good

-2004: We have a new enemy, (camera front view of Emperor) the young rebel who destroyed the Death Star. (camera front view of Vader from the shoulders up) I have no doubt this boy is the offspring of Anakin Skywalker. (camera front view of Emperor)
I will be changing this line to just "young Skywalker". I would have preferred it to be "Luke Skywalker" but no where in the saga does the Emperor say "Luke"
As for the vane it is a bit of a design flaw. I think that Luke was supposed to have reached there through the long tunnel but they put the support pole in the wrong position on the matte which caused confusion. A small tweak to the matte should be able to fix this.
The Obi-Wan line about Yoda i would prefer to keep this as it is. I don't want to have to changed much in the OT just because of the mess that the POT caused. I have some plans to fix this error in the PT and not have OBi-Wan as Qui-Gon's padawan but instead have Yopa call Obi-Wan his padawan in some instances in TPM or maybe just omit the whole padawan thing with Obi-Wan altogether

Originally posted by: Joshua_Blue
In my view, the shield is only impenetrable by lasers and other similar weapons. The ships can pass through the shield normally they just cannot fire through it. That is why the land beyond the horizon of the Hoth rebel base, out of the reach of the rebel fire, and attack with walkers. If they landed directly in front of the rebel base, they would be vulnerable during landing.
Well actually not even ships can get through the shield. Don't forget that they have to lower the shield for the transports to escape so my thought on this is that once the shield is lowered the walkers can slip through .
An interesting idea popped up earlier in the thread about seeing drop ships deploying the AT-AT's. But i feel that adding anything like that in would ruin the reveal of the AT-AT's when we see them through the macrobinoulars and would just be adding something in to the film that really doesn't need to be there. That's the thing i'm trying to avoid and that's the thing that Lucasfilm did with the SE's.
Also adding any sort of vision during Luke's training won't be happening. That's another thing we don't need to see . Luke describes his vision perfectly.
